Current Price Action and Market Context

As of 24 Jul 2026, Kirloskar Ferrous Industries Ltd (stock code 331572) closed at ₹464.60, down 1.37% from the previous close of ₹471.05. The stock traded within a narrow intraday range, hitting a high of ₹467.10 and a low of ₹460.20. This price action remains well below its 52-week high of ₹617.50 but comfortably above the 52-week low of ₹336.20, indicating a recovery phase from the lows seen earlier in the year.

In comparison, the broader Sensex index has shown a more resilient performance year-to-date, with a return of -10.36% versus Kirloskar Ferrous’ -3.42%. Over longer horizons, the stock has outperformed the Sensex significantly, delivering a 5-year return of 68.09% compared to the Sensex’s 44.20%, and an impressive 10-year return of 578.25% against the Sensex’s 174.76%. However, the stock’s 1-year return of -21.91% lags behind the Sensex’s -7.66%, reflecting recent sectoral and company-specific challenges.

MACD and Momentum Indicators

The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D) indicator presents a mixed picture. On the weekly chart, the MACD is bullish, signalling increasing upward momentum. However, the monthly MACD remains bearish, reflecting the longer-term caution among investors. This divergence suggests that while short-term momentum is improving, the stock has yet to confirm a sustained uptrend over the medium to long term.

The Know Sure Thing (KST) indicator aligns with this view, showing bullish momentum on the weekly timeframe but bearish signals on the monthly chart. This reinforces the notion of a potential short-term rally within a broader uncertain trend.

RSI and Bollinger Bands Analysis

The Relative Strength Index (RSI) currently shows no clear signal on both weekly and monthly charts, hovering in a neutral zone. This indicates that the stock is neither overbought nor oversold, leaving room for further directional movement based on upcoming market catalysts.

Bollinger Bands provide additional insight, with a mildly bullish stance on the weekly chart and mildly bearish on the monthly. The weekly Bollinger Bands suggest the stock is gaining upward momentum but has not yet broken out decisively. Conversely, the monthly bands imply some resistance and volatility in the longer term.

Volume and On-Balance Volume (OBV) Trends

On-Balance Volume (OBV) is mildly bullish on the weekly chart, indicating that buying volume is gradually increasing relative to selling volume. This supports the notion of accumulating interest among traders and investors in the short term. However, the monthly OBV shows no clear trend, suggesting that longer-term volume dynamics remain inconclusive.

Dow Theory and Market Sentiment

According to Dow Theory analysis, the weekly trend is mildly bullish, reflecting a tentative shift in market sentiment towards optimism. The monthly trend, however, shows no definitive trend, underscoring the cautious stance of investors over a longer horizon.
